Transaction 925255ee4a20c30db93ff77e17a47d38d07b5a4c773d969abac3bdc60fb91ce2
1 Input
1 Outputs
- 925255ee4a20c30db93ff77e17a47d38d07b5a4c773d969abac3bdc60fb91ce2:0
value 118370
address 1HbNaVQZmmZhdMhTpLnZZ4eTevhFqdHcxa